Here to talk a little about the relationship between the creative director and editor in chief.
Anna always shows up as as "ice woman". She seldom smells and her tone is freezing, every one in the building is under her super pressure. But only Grace has a particular relation with her. They are complementary to each other. Anna envision a macro picture while Grace carries out the vision into concrete products. They are both talented and have their own style; they bicker with each other, they fight over ideas but they respect each other more. Some one might feel unfair for Grace since she and Anna joined the company at the same time but now Anna is the "devil". But if I am Grace I would be extremely grateful for Anna. It is her keep pushing Grace into better ideas. People easily fall in love with their own ideas. If not someone jumped out and wake you up, you would always stay at the same place, unable to move forward. Obviously in the movie Grace's second piece is much stronger than the first one. Anna might not have that many brilliant ideas as Grace does, but she definitely has the ability to dig out Grace's potential.
